backdraft en · NOUN

Pronunciation

  • /ˈbækˌdɹæft/ (General-American)

Etymology

From back + draft.

Meanings

  1. (US) Sudden, dangerous recombustion that occurs when there is a rapid reintroduction of oxygen to an enclosed space containing a fire.
